David Folkenflik / NPR:
Susan Stamberg, an original NPR staffer who went on to become the first US woman to anchor a nightly national news program, has died at 87 — Susan Stamberg, an original National Public Radio staffer who went on to become the first U.S. woman to anchor a nightly national news program, died Thursday at the age of 87.
Alex Weprin / The Hollywood Reporter:
Apple and NBCUniversal announce an Apple TV and Peacock Premium bundle for $14.99 per month, a 30% discount over the individual subscriptions — In addition to getting both services at a discount of more than 30 percent, Apple TV will add select Peacock programming, while Peacock will get selected Apple TV shows.

Ted Johnson / Deadline:
CNN plans to launch its All Access streaming subscription tier on October 28 for $6.99 per month or $69.99 per year in the US — CNN is making another go of it with a subscription service, announcing an Oct. 28 launch for its “all access” service at a price of $6.99 per month.

Brian Steinberg / Variety:
CBS News' Standards chief Claudia Milne announces her departure, becoming the first senior executive to leave since the arrival of Bari Weiss as EIC — Claudia Milne, who has overseen standards and practices at CBS News since 2021, announced her departure from the Paramount Skydance unit Thursday morning …
Angela Giuffrida / The Guardian:
The Italian federation of newspaper publishers submits a complaint to Italy's communication watchdog calling for an investigation into Google's AI Overviews — Newspaper federation says ‘traffic killer’ feature violates legislation and threatens to destroy media diversity
Jessica Davies / Digiday:
The Economist, the FT, and Dow Jones are licensing their archives and live content to enterprise clients for use in their private LLMs — Publishers are increasingly licensing decades of archived reporting to corporate clients' private LLMs — a potential path to recurring …
